IRVING, Texas - Last month Iowa State redshirt senior Kyven Gadson solidified himself as one of the nation's top wrestlers and today he was recognized as one of the best off the mat as well. The 197-pound NCAA champion was honored as the 2015 Big 12 Wrestling Scholar-Athlete of the Year.
Gadson, the 69th national champion in Cyclone wrestling history, is working toward a Master's Degree in Higher Education. He maintains a 3.11 grade point average and serves as the co-president of the 2014-15 Iowa State Student-Athlete Advisory Committee(SAAC). He is also the president of the Big 12 SAAC for the 2014-15 school year.
The Waterloo, Iowa native ended his senior campaign with a 30-1 mark and became the 19th Cyclone wrestler to win at least three conference titles. He outscored his opponents at the 2015 NCAA Championships by a total of 38-11 without surrendering a takedown. He capped off his career as a three-time All-American.
Gadson is a two-time Academic All-Big 12 first-team member.
